FAI 2023 Fall Days: what to see in the northern regions of Italy.

14 and October 15, 2023 FAI Fall Days returns for its twelfth edition. FAI youth groups and volunteers from the Foundation's Territorial Network will offer special free visits this weekend. There will be the opportunity to visit magnificent sites, real cultural, historical and architectural treasures scattered throughout the country and often inaccessible or simply little known and undervalued: palaces, villas, libraries, gardens, examples of industrial archaeology, laboratories, botanical gardens, city parks, museums and art collections, and much more.

This edition of FAI Fall Days involves 700 venues in more than 350 Italian cities: here is the list of open venues in the northern regions.

Palazzo delle Uffizi'. 'Financiari - Agenzia delle Entrate (Milan)

Palazzo della Banca d'Italia (Milan)

The Verdi Theater (Milan)

Piccolo Teatro Grassi (Milan)

Università Politecnico di Milano: research activities on the Duomo (Milan)

Saint'\''Agostino: 700 years of history - University of Bergamo (Bergamo)

Music and Youth: Palazzo Martinengo Cesaresco del Aquilone (Brescia)

Villa Crivelli, Arconati, Pusterla and the Castiglioni Institute (Limbiate, MB)

Venina hydroelectric power plant (Piyada, CO)

Motor ship Capitanio 1926 (Predore, BS)

What to see in Friuli-Venezia Giulia:

The central office of the University of Trieste and the Gaetano Canizza exhibition (Trieste)

Ratusha, venue'. 'municipality (Trieste)

Amideria Chiotza (Ruda, UD)

What to see in Liguria:

The Gustavo Modena Theater (Genoa)

Vezzano Superiore Historic District (Vezzano Ligure, SP)

What to see in Emilia-Romagna:

Palazzo of the Bank of Italy (Bologna)

Palazzo Malvezzi de' Medici (Bologna)

College of Venturoli (Bologna)

Palazzo Bevilazzqua Costabili - Department of Economics and Management, University of Ferrara (Ferrara)

Argenta and Don Minzoni: after the storm (Argenta, FE)

Academy of Fine Arts (Ravenna)

What to see in Piedmont:

Cinema Commission Turin Piedmont (Turin)

Palazzo di Citta (Turin)

The Church of the Monastery of San Bernardino (Ivrea,'''TO)

The Church and Monastery of San Francesco d'Assisi (Rivarolo Canavese, TO)

Castle of Bardassano (Gassino Torinese, TO)

What to see in Trentino Alto Adige:

The former tobacco manufactory (Rovereto, TN)

What to see in Valle d'Aosta:

What to see in Courmayeur (Courmayeur, TN)

What to see in Veneto:

Cluastri San Zaccaria (Venice)

Scuola Grande di San Marco (Venice)

New Santa Agnese - Alberto Peruzzo Foundation (Padua)
